Core Command for Updating Ruby with Homebrew

According to the best answer, the core command to update Ruby to the latest stable version is brew upgrade ruby. This command checks for the latest version of the Ruby formula in the Homebrew repository and performs the installation. Unlike brew update, which only updates Homebrew itself and its formula list, brew upgrade ruby upgrades the installed package. Understanding this distinction is essential for effective Ruby environment management.

When executing brew upgrade ruby, Homebrew handles dependencies to ensure all necessary libraries and tools are in place. For instance, if a new Ruby version requires updates to OpenSSL or other system components, Homebrew automatically manages these dependencies. This simplifies the developer workflow, avoiding the complexity of manual configuration.

Version Management and Stability Considerations

While brew upgrade ruby typically installs the latest version, developers may prioritize stability over novelty. Homebrew formulas are usually marked for stable releases, but developers can verify this by inspecting formula details. Using brew info ruby allows viewing available versions and stability information, helping balance the pursuit of new features with system stability.

Additionally, other tools mentioned in the Q&A data, such as rbenv and ruby-build, offer finer-grained version control. For example, rbenv install 3.3.0 installs a specific version, and rbenv global 3.3.0 sets it as the default. This approach is useful for scenarios requiring multiple Ruby versions, such as testing project compatibility across different releases.

Practical Steps and Common Issues

To ensure a smooth update, it is recommended to follow these steps: first, run brew update to update the Homebrew formula list, then execute brew upgrade ruby to install the latest stable version. After updating, verify the version with ruby -v. If permission issues arise, using sudo or adjusting Homebrew installation path permissions may be necessary.

Common issues include version conflicts or dependency errors. For instance, if Ruby is already installed via other means (e.g., macOS's built-in Ruby), Homebrew might indicate conflicts. In such cases, prioritize the Homebrew version and adjust environment variables like PATH. Use echo $PATH to check the path order, ensuring Homebrew's Ruby takes precedence.

In-Depth Analysis: Interaction Between Homebrew and System Ruby

macOS typically comes with a pre-installed Ruby, but it may be outdated. Homebrew installs Ruby in a separate directory (e.g., /usr/local/opt/ruby), avoiding conflicts with the system Ruby. During updates, Homebrew manages symbolic links to ensure the ruby command points to the new version. Developers can confirm the current Ruby path using which ruby.
